LaCie has announced a new version of its powered hub, and this time it comes in a USB only flavor. It sports 7 USB 2.0 connections that should suit most of your needs (4 type A female, 2 type mini B female, and 1 type A female). They also have a USB & FireWire version that comes with a flashlight and fan as well. LaCie owes the fashionable look to French designer Ora-Ïto, who helped them design the LaCie Brick Hard Drive and Golden Disk. The hub comes in at a pricey $79 for the USB only version and $89 for the USB & FireWire version but at least it comes with all of the cables that you will need to connect it to your PC or Mac.
